Java Software Engineer I (H/F)
Website ANSYS
Date: Jun 18, 2020
Location: Toulouse, FR, 31100 Villeneuve Loubet, FR, 6270
Company: Ansys
Ansys is the global leader in engineering simulation, helping the world’s most innovative companies deliver radically better products to their customers. By offering the best and broadest portfolio of engineering simulation software, Ansys helps companies solve the most complex design challenges and engineer products limited only by imagination.
DESCRIPTION
The position is located at the ANSYS Research and Development office in Toulouse, France (31) or in Villeneuve-Loubet France (06).
ANSYS is looking for a skilled and highly motivated Java developer to join the development team. You will use your skills and acquire new ones around Java programming, the use of EMF and Eclipse platforms.
As part of our ANSYS SCADE product offer, model-based development and simulation environment for embedded software in the Automotive or Aeronautical sectors, you will have the mission to participate in the development of our MBSE tools and their coupling with tools that meet standards (such as AUTOSAR or FACE) as well as requirements management tools (ALM / PLM). As a member of the ANSYS France Research and Development team, you play an active role in the development of our SCADE products
RESPONSIBILITIES
Your main missions will be:
– The specification of the requested functionalities,
– The architectural and algorithmic specifications of the software,
– The development and integration of software components,
– The monitoring and maintenance of published versions,
– Writing technical documentation
You collaborate with teams dedicated to product management, tests, user documentation and quality, as well as with other R&D teams.
MINIMUM QUALIFICATIONS
- Minimum 2-3 years of experience in a similar position
- You are a Master’s level graduate of an engineering school or a computer science university
- You have significant experience in software engineering
- Programming in Java
- You like programming
PREFERRED QUALIFICATIONS
- Practice of Eclipse and EMF
- Knowledge of Python is a plus
- Knowledge of code generation, user interface design, synchronous language (e.g., SCADE or Luster) or AUTOSAR or FACE standards is highly appreciated.
- Your autonomy, your curiosity, your team spirit and your adaptability will be important assets to succeed in your missions.
- The position being integrated in an international environment, a good level of English is necessary.
The Data Crisis is Unfolding – Are We Ready?